EDITORS COMMENTS
This print from the Liszt Collection transports us back to 1865, capturing a moment frozen in time at the Glasgow Hunterian Museum. Renowned Scottish photographer George Washington Wilson skillfully composed this albumen silver print, showcasing his exceptional talent and attention to detail. The image reveals the grandeur of the Hunterian Museum, with its majestic architecture and imposing presence. The museum stands as a testament to Scotland's rich cultural heritage and intellectual pursuits. Its walls house an extensive collection of scientific specimens, archaeological artifacts, and artistic masterpieces that captivate visitors from all walks of life. Wilson's expert use of light and shadow brings depth and texture to this photograph. Each intricate detail is beautifully rendered, allowing viewers to appreciate the craftsmanship that went into constructing this remarkable institution.
